Output 9660486e49258e828677480d43095a2838f52aea31332ce0e2d4a03ea7fec805:0

value
17674000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4b742d36ef251c3fb66c2eacbc4ff800bfd00a4 OP_EQUALVERIFY OP_CHECKSIG
address
1HUYAjKd5YxvpUkoNMbSEZYeezLRbX5sGr
transaction
9660486e49258e828677480d43095a2838f52aea31332ce0e2d4a03ea7fec805
spent
true